MILLSTONE TOWNSHIP FOUNDATION FOR EDUCATIONAL EXCELLENCE
RAISED MORE THAN $3,900 AT ITS FOURTH ANNUAL “FAMILY MOVIE DAY”
Millstone Township Foundation for Educational Excellence (MTFEE) raised more than $3,900 from its Fourth Annual “Family Movie Day” held on November 16 at the Millstone Township Performing Arts Center (MPAC). Proceeds will help provide grant funding for innovative classroom programs, educational opportunities for students, staff development, and state-of-the-art teaching materials that are beyond the scope of the general school budget to enrich education for the district's public school students.
The event opened with an hour and a half of children's activities including minute-to-win-it games with prizes, face painting, crafts and temporary tattoos. The activities were followed by a screening of “The Lego Movie”—a movie that won a school township wide student vote.

Additionally, Vesuvio’s Pizzeria & Family Restaurant donated 10 percent of each dining check that day and then matched that amount, for a total donation of $250.
The foundation also collected non-perishable food items and ShopRite gift cards that day for Millstone Township families in need.
MTFEE operates independently from the school district and replenishes its grant fund exclusively through private donations and its fundraising efforts. The foundation has awarded more than $486,670 in grants to Millstone Township schools since 2002. MTFEE grants, which have been awarded at every grade level and in every discipline, have included a book room, STEAM enrichment programs, SMARTBoards ® , mobile computer and iPad ™ labs, and a rock climbing wall.
There are currently more than 60 MTFEE-funded grant programs running. Every child that matriculates through the school district will in some way benefit from an MTFEE-funded grant. MTFEE is a member of New Jersey Education Foundation Partnership and The National Consortium of State and Local Education Foundations (NCEFS).

About MTFEE
From its initial conception in 1995 to its designation as a 501©3 charitable organization in 2002, the Millstone Township Foundation for Educational Excellence (MTFEE) has remained steadfast in its goal to fund grants for items that nurture extraordinary educational experiences for every student in Millstone Township Public Schools and are beyond the scope of the general school budget. Items include innovative classroom programs, educational opportunities for students, staff development, and state-of-the-art teaching materials. Through the creativity of the teaching staff’s grant applications and the fundraising efforts of MTFEE, the foundation is proud to have awarded more than $486,670 in grants to Millstone Township schools. MTFEE grants, which have been awarded at every grade level and in every discipline, have included STEAM enrichment programs, a book room, SMARTBoards ® , mobile computer and iPad ™ labs and a rock climbing wall. MTFEE was the first organization in the district to put iPads ™ into the classroom in the spring of 2011. There are currently more than 60 MTFEE-funded grant programs running. Every child that matriculates through the school district will in some way benefit from an MTFEE-funded grant. MTFEE is a member of New Jersey Education Foundation Partnership and The National Consortium of State and Local Education Foundations (NCEFS).
